Form 4: Patterson-UTI CEO Reports Stock Withholding Transaction

Sentiment:

Insider Transaction Report


CEO William Andrew Hendricks Jr. disposed of 31,677 shares of Patterson-UTI Energy to cover tax obligations related to restricted stock units.

Summary

  • CEO William Andrew Hendricks Jr. executed a transaction involving 31,677 shares of common stock.
  • The transaction was a disposition of shares to satisfy tax withholding requirements upon the vesting of restricted stock units.
  • The shares were valued at $12.29 per share.
  • Following this transaction, the CEO maintains a beneficial ownership of 2,791,426 shares of Patterson-UTI Energy.
